Figure prefix database does not exist and could not be recreated

Anybody ever had this error? The file is in the proper location. I used this a few days ago with no problem. Any ideas? Thanks!

One more thing is it won't even let me create a new figure prefix database. It says, "The figure prefix database does not exist and could not be recreated.

I saw this once. When it happened, a "Figures.fdb.compacted" file had mysteriously appeared beside my "Figures.fdb" file. I deleted the "Figures.fdb.compacted" file, and everything returned to normal.

Thanks for replying, Sinc. I don't have the "compacted" file, so I just copied someone else's Sample.fdb and started over. I did learn that you can edit these files with MS Access. That makes re-creating the file a lot faster.
